PranaSleep's Jason Goodman on Leadership, Mentorship & Success
from The BedBuzz · host Harry Roberts and Jimmy Hill
What does it take to go from selling mattresses on the sales floor to becoming one of the fastest-rising executives in Mattress Firm history?In this episode of The BedBuzz Podcast, We sit down with Jason Goodman to explore an incredible career built on hard work, mentorship, leadership, and a willingness to take risks.Jason shares the lessons he learned from industry legends including Gary Fazio, Steve Stagner, Philip Busker, Charlie Roberts, and Harry Roberts, along with the leadership principles that shaped his success. He also discusses his entrepreneurial journey, what he learned outside the mattress industry, and why he returned to help grow PranaSleep across the country.You'll hear stories about Mattress Firm's explosive growth years, franchise expansion, building high-performing teams, the importance of mentors, and Jason's simple leadership philosophy: Love. Money. Metrics.Whether you're a retail salesperson, manager, business owner, or industry veteran, this episode is packed with practical leadership lessons and entertaining stories from one of the industry's most respected leaders.And of course...stick around until the end for Jason's craziest mattress sale!
